Does the DCSTB supply allows flexibility for pass transistor? Like a mosfet like irfp240/9240 +adjusting the current resistor for bc550? Or even paralleling BJT pass transistor (for higher current)?
Does the DCSTB supply allows flexibility for pass transistor? Like a mosfet like irfp240/9240 +adjusting the current resistor for bc550? Or even paralleling BJT pass transistor (for higher current)?
Looked into it, for IRFP pass elements R3 R4 should be 470R, also add 100R gate stoppers. Vin-Vout should be kept at no less than 5V else drop out will start there due to Vgs is high vs Vbe when normally using a BJT pass. But not >>5V either if used for high current loads because of dissipation & sinking concerns.
